Features Galore
What really sets this app apart are the features. You’ve got your basic controls like volume and channel navigation, but it doesn’t stop there. There’s a whole suite of options to explore:
- Voice Control: Say goodbye to manual searches! Just speak into your phone, and the app does the rest.
- Keyboard Input: Typing in those long Netflix searches just got a whole lot easier.
- Smart Guide: Browse through channels and programs with detailed info at your fingertips.
- Media Player: Control playback on your TV directly from your phone.

Performance
In terms of performance, the app is pretty solid. I’ve tested it over a few days, and there’s hardly any lag. It responds quickly, and I didn’t notice any major bugs. Occasionally, the connection might drop if there’s an issue with your Wi-Fi, but reconnecting is usually seamless.
The app doesn’t seem to drain my phone’s battery excessively, which is a huge plus. I appreciate that I can use it for extended periods without worrying about my phone dying halfway through a binge-watching session.
Compatibility
One thing to note is that the app is primarily designed for Philips Smart TVs, so if you’ve got a different brand, you might be out of luck. However, for those loyal to Philips, this is a game-changer. It supports a wide range of Philips models, so chances are, you’ll be covered.
